What seems so insignificant to mankind turns out to be of extreme importance to God. What does God point out about Abraham, the FATHER of Believers/believing? (Romans 4:16)

Genesis 18:18–19

[18] seeing that Abraham shall surely become a great and mighty nation, and all the nations of the earth shall be blessed in him? [19] For I have chosen him, that he may command his children and his household after him to keep the way of the LORD by doing righteousness and justice, so that the LORD may bring to Abraham what he has promised him.” (ESV)

So many are deceived into thinking that "real life", the important things - careers, social status, entertainment, ministries, and etc., all are outside the home and the family. Thus, the family becomes an unwelcome distraction of additional responsibilities. If you want to do something of REAL IMPORTANCE for God, FOCUS on RAISING YOUR FAMILY in the nurture and admonition of the Lord!
